What Does an a Auto Insurance Agent in Zionsville Cost?
The average cost of auto insurance in Indiana is around 1200 dollars per year for full coverage but rates vary by driver profile. Factors like age driving record and vehicle type affect premiums. In Zionsville rates may be slightly different than state average due to local claims trends. This is general information and not insurance advice.
About auto insurance agents in Zionsville
An auto insurance agent in Zionsville Indiana can help you find coverage that meets Indiana state requirements. Indiana law requires all drivers to carry minimum liability insurance of 25000 dollars for bodily injury per person and 50000 dollars per accident. A local agent can also explain options for uninsured motorist coverage and comprehensive plans.
Frequently Asked Questions
What are the minimum auto insurance requirements in Indiana?
Indiana requires drivers to have liability coverage of at least 25000 dollars per person for bodily injury and 50000 dollars per accident. Property damage liability must be at least 25000 dollars. An agent in Zionsville can help you meet these legal minimums.

Does Indiana require uninsured motorist coverage?
Indiana does not require uninsured motorist coverage but insurance companies must offer it. You can reject it in writing. An agent can explain the benefits of adding this coverage to your policy.
